The Significance of the Christmas Tree

Christmas trees are more than just decorations; they represent hope, joy, and the spirit of giving during the holiday season. Originating in Germany in the 16th century, the tradition of using evergreen trees has evolved over the years to become a central piece of Christmas celebrations worldwide.
What does a Christmas tree symbolize?
A Christmas tree symbolizes life and renewal, serving as a reminder that even during the coldest, darkest months of the year, life endures. It's often adorned with lights and ornaments, each representing various stories and memories.

Choosing the Right Christmas Tree

When it comes to selecting the ideal Christmas tree, there are many factors to consider, including type, size, and location. Popular types include:
- Fraser Fir
- Noble Fir
- Douglas Fir
- Pine Trees
Each variety offers a unique fragrance, shape, and needle retention rate, making it essential to choose one that suits your family’s preferences.
How do I make my Christmas tree last longer?
To extend the life of your Christmas tree, ensure it’s well-watered and kept away from heat sources. Consider cutting an inch off the trunk before placing it in water to allow better absorption.

Decorating the Christmas Tree

Decorating your Christmas tree offers a chance for creativity and family bonding. When done thoughtfully, it can reflect your family's values and traditions. Here are some decorating tips:
- Start with lights before adding ornaments.
- Use a mix of old and new decorations to create a unique look.
- Incorporate personal touches, like handmade ornaments or family photos.
What are some popular Christmas tree themes?
Many families choose themes for their Christmas tree, such as traditional, rustic, or modern. Popular trends often include color schemes like silver and blue, or classic red and gold.

Best Practices for Post-Christmas Tree Care

After the holiday season, the care for your Christmas tree doesn’t end. Here are some useful tips:
- Check local guidelines for disposal.
- Consider recycling options for creating mulch.
- Plan for early removal to avoid fire hazards.
Can I plant my Christmas tree after the holidays?
If your Christmas tree was grown in a pot and hasn’t been subjected to extreme temperature changes, it’s safe to plant it outside after the holidays.
